Clopyralid is an organochlorine pesticide having a 3,6-dichlorinated picolinic acid structure. It has a role as a herbicide. It is a member of pyridines and an organochlorine pesticide. It is functionally related to a picolinic acid.

| Molecular formula | C6H3Cl2NO2 |
|---|---|
| Molecular weight | 192.00 g/mol |
| IUPAC name | 3,6-dichloropyridine-2-carboxylic acid |
| InChIKey | HUBANNPOLNYSAD-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| SMILES | C1=CC(=NC(=C1Cl)C(=O)O)Cl |
